Researchers seek $117,000 to improve peatland revegetation methods; LCCMR does not award emergency funds
Summary
A University of Minnesota researcher asked LCCMR for $117,000 to upgrade an experimental peatland facility and test revegetation methods; commissioners voted down the emerging-issue request.

University of Minnesota researcher Chris Linhardt presented a proposal to the Legislative-Citizen Commission on Minnesota Resources on June 11 asking for $117,000 from the emerging-issues account to upgrade an experimental peatland mesocosm facility on the Saint Paul campus. The project would test water chemistry, water-level and vegetation strategies intended to improve revegetation success on peatland restorations in northern Minnesota.
Linhardt, a research professor in Bioproducts and Biosystems Engineering who also works with The Nature Conservancy in Minnesota, told commissioners peatland restoration is increasingly pursued for carbon storage, water storage and habitat benefits but that many impoundment restoration sites fail to revegetate with sphagnum moss and other peatland species. He proposed buying equipment and supplies and funding a graduate student for 18 months to run controlled mesocosm tests of pH control, water-level management and planting approaches; he said results would be shared in near-real-time with ongoing restoration projects north of the Red Lake area so design choices could be informed now.
Staff described the request as time-sensitive because many restoration projects are entering design and construction phases over the next several years. Linhardt said Saint Paul tap water has a relatively high pH (above 8) and the mesocosm requires acidic conditions (pH ~5) more typical of bog rainfall; proposed work would test water-harvest and treatment approaches, vegetation mixes and water-level regimes.
Representative Emma Lillie moved a recommendation to fund the request for $117,000, but the motion failed in a roll call: yes 4, no 11. Commissioners who opposed the emergency appropriation cited prioritization of the emerging-issues account for unexpected urgent events and suggested peatland restoration research may be more appropriate for the regular competitive RFP or other grant programs. Supporters said the project would directly inform imminent and numerous restoration projects, improving carbon and hydrologic outcomes.
Ending: The LCCMR did not recommend the emerging-issue appropriation. Research proponents said the facility work remains an identified need and they will pursue other funding opportunities and collaborations with DNR, Fish and Wildlife Service and The Nature Conservancy.
